An explosion has occurred in Kano State just hours after a female suicide bomber attacked a bus station in Yobe State.
Bomb blast hits Kano park
The latest bomb went off at about 3:15pm on Tuesday, February 23, at Kano Line, one of the state’s busiest parks, which is located along Zaria Road.
Recommended articles
Security agencies and aid workers are said to be working in the area to assess the damage and rush victims to the nearest hospital.
No official casualty figure has been released but the toll is expected to be high due to the crowded nature of the area.
